  • Board farming is an important topic for embedded Linux development: It allows developers to share their hardware and lays the foundation for continuous testing of BSPs and applications on real hardware. With this talk I want to continue the discussion on how to control large numbers of Embedded Devices in a lab. I will begin with a short introduction on how Pengutronix currently operates their board farm: I will give you an overview on the hardware we use and how we use labgrid to support interactive work and automated testing of our devices under test. Afterwards I will give some insight of the everyday life with 150+ slots in the Pengutronix lab and what the most annoying (and expensive) problems are. To mitigate most of the problem my team and I are currently working on a new way to organize our labs: We try to shift our labs from a centralized architecture with many devices connected to a few control servers to a distributed structure where every device under test is controlled by its own test automation controller. I will conclude my talk with a discussion of the pros and cons of this design that we already discovered.
